Handover — Reception, Drayfield Tower

Iona: two lost badges reported today, both suspended in the system. Replacements were ordered from Kestwick Print and should arrive Wednesday. Both staff members have paper passes valid through tomorrow. If either needs level 4 before then, walk them up or give them the temporary code below.

turnstile pass: bdg-JVSWH-52711

Prepared for sales leads. The six-store pilot with Oaklane Retail concluded with sell-through ahead of forecast in four locations and roughly on plan in the remaining two. Gross margin held at target despite promotional support in the launch month, and returns stayed below the contractual threshold. Inventory turns improved steadily from week five onward. Finance considers the unit economics sound enough to support a wider rollout discussion. The confidential note below outlines the intended next phase.

board note of bawep-tajef: Queniusek Systems plans to raise the Quenvan list price by 53.1 percent in March. The pricing group signed off on a budget of $176.4 million for Project Drueth. The renewal with Casionix Partners closes at $142.5 million a year, 8.3 percent below the last contract. Project Fraax slips by six weeks because of the tooling delay.

CI note for new contractors — Notification fan-out backpressure. If the Pellworth CI suite stalls on the fan-out stage, the queue simulator is likely saturating its in-memory buffer; this is expected above 50k synthetic subscribers. Lower the subscriber count in the test config rather than raising timeouts, since timeouts mask real regressions. When filing a flake report, include the pipeline token printed below.

pipeline stamp: htk3_cc5

Off-site run checklist — item 4. Notarised deed for the Bramleigh plot, sealed envelope, red wax intact. Collect from the Tarnwell office safe, sign the custody sheet, no stops between pickup and the registry drop. Driver must not leave the vehicle unattended with the envelope inside. Coordinator confirms the run window by phone. Pass the courier the hand-over instruction that follows.

courier memo of tawep-tajep: the quenius ulaiel courier leaves the fenir ledger at gate 9128 under passcode 527513